Crea backup dalla riga di comando in Mac OS X con questi 4 trucchi
In questi giorni non mancano i modi per eseguire il backup del tuo Macintosh. Probabilmente il metodo più popolare a disposizione di un utente finale è Time Machine di Apple, che viene gestito automaticamente dopo una semplice configurazione tramite la GUI o può essere attivato per l'avvio in qualsiasi momento. Personalmente, sono rimasto molto colpito dalla facilità d'uso offerta da Time Machine, ma sono un drogato della riga di comando, quindi devo riferire sulle alternative disponibili, quattro delle quali risiedono nella stessa riga di comando di Mac OS X.
Continua a leggere per scoprire alcuni metodi diversi che puoi utilizzare nel terminale per eseguire il backup del tuo Mac, utilizzando ditto, rsync, asr e hdiutil.
1) idem
sudo idem -X src_directory dst_directory
Ditto è una parte integrata di Mac OS X e viene fornito con tutte le versioni. Ditto è abbastanza robusto e può eseguire il backup dei file preservando sia gli attributi di proprietà che i fork delle risorse. Una caratteristica elegante offerta da Ditto è la sua capacità di "assottigliare" i binari del loro codice PPC o i386. Ad esempio, se possiedi un vecchio Macintosh PPC puoi aggiungere –arch ppc alle opzioni della riga di comando e ogni file binario di cui viene eseguito il backup verrà privato del suo codice binario x86. Ciò si tradurrà in backup più piccoli.
2) rsync
sudo rsync -xrlptgoEv --progress --delete src_directory dst_directory
Rsync è un metodo versatile e popolare per eseguire backup non solo su Mac ma anche su server Linux e Unix in tutto il "globo IT".Rsync può fare tutto il necessario per eseguire un backup affidabile del tuo sistema OS X, inclusi i fork delle risorse e la conservazione della capacità del tuo disco rigido di essere "avviabile". Uno sguardo approfondito alle abilità di rysnc può essere trovato qui.
3) asr
sudo asr -source src_directory -target dst_directory -erase -noprompt
asr, o l'utilità Applica ripristino software è un altro modo eccellente ed efficiente per eseguire un backup. ASR può fare tutto ciò che può fare Ditto in più ha la capacità di copiare un disco rigido a livello di blocco. Il livello di blocco è la forma "più bassa" possibile per accedere a un disco rigido e fornisce una vera replica al 100% dei dati. La funzionalità a livello di blocco di ASR deve essere eseguita su dischi rigidi che non sono attualmente montati nel sistema operativo. Questo in genere significa avviare da un disco di ripristino, installazione USB o simili.
4) hdiutil
sudo hdiutil create dst_image.dmg -format UDZO -nocrossdev -srcdir src_directory
Se hai mai desiderato creare un semplice e singolo backup di file del tuo Macintosh, allora hdiutil fa per te. Hdiutil esegue un backup su un singolo file immagine disco (facoltativamente compresso) che può essere ripristinato utilizzando il software Utility Disco di Apple.